Abstract
A battery charger can include a charger controller configured to determine a total charge time that characterizes a time needed to charge a battery, the total charge time being based on a received state of charge (SOC) of the battery that characterizes a present SOC of the battery. The charger controller can also be configured to determine a charging start time for the battery based on a predetermined full charge time and the total charge time.

1. A battery charger comprising:
-
a memory storing battery parameters, including a battery time constant and a present state of charge; and a charger controller coupled to the memory, and configured to; determine a transitional state of charge based on a difference between the predetermined current and a taper current, the full charge capacity, the battery time constant, and the present state of charge; determine a total charge time based on the battery time constant, the present state of charge, and the transitional state of charge; determine a charging start time based on the total charge time; maintain the battery at the present state of charge below a full charge capacity of the battery before the charging start time; supply a predetermined current to charge the battery after the charging start time and before the battery reaches the transitional state of charge; and supply a predetermined voltage to charge the battery after the battery reaches the transitional state of charge. - View Dependent Claims (2, 3, 4, 5, 6, 7, 8)
